Director

Lori Traweek

Appointment:
Governor Appointee to represent Environmental Concern
Term:
Expires June 16, 2029

Lori Traweek served as CEO and General Manager of the Gulf Coast Authority, leading efforts to protect Texas waterways and advance sustainable water management. During her 27-year tenure, she guided major wastewater and water quality initiatives and played a key role in shaping regional and state water policy.

Board & Committee Service:

  • Texas Conservation Fund (Trash Bash ), President
  • Galveston Bay Foundation, Emeritus Board Member (Past Chair)
  • Texas Water Trade, Board Member
  • Trinity-San Jacinto Rivers, Galveston Bay Basin, Bay Area Stakeholders Committee, Member
  • Galveston Bay Estuary Program, Budget and Priorities Subcommittee (Past Chair)

Career Highlights:

CEO and General Manager of the Gulf Coast Authority

Education:

B.S. in Aquatic & Fisheries Biology, University of Southwestern Louisiana

Residence:

Seabrook, Texas
